Transaction 52fc24ba7d3dd1b8a13d1fee6308676d2ab9efd5ac1f274140b412f09ed11a82
1 Input
1 Output
-
52fc24ba7d3dd1b8a13d1fee6308676d2ab9efd5ac1f274140b412f09ed11a82:0
- value
- 27318985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b17f1663bf818232c445ea69b03e503258266e5 OP_EQUAL
- address
- 3P85QD9uS8hx4KvVTkT4ESpbzrLxntNnUz